What this permit is not

A well permit is the State Engineer’s permission to construct and use a well — it is not a decreed water right and confers none. DWR’s record limits its use to: Monitoring/Sampling (category Monitoring Hole (Notice of Intent)).

It carries no WDID, so nothing on the decreed side of this site describes it. For an exempt household or stock well that is normal: such a well is exempt from administration in the priority system — a river call does not curtail it — and never needed a decree. For a non-exempt use it may mean the application expired, was denied, or was permitted under an augmentation plan DWR has not linked here. How permits, decrees and monitoring wells differ →
